Effect of Adjunctive Aripiprazole on Sexual Dysfunction in Schizophrenia: A Preliminary Open-Label Study
J Fujioi1, K Iwamoto1, M Banno1
1Department of Psychiatry, Nagoya University Graduate School of Medicine, Tsurumai-cho, Showa-ku, Nagoya, Aichi, Japan.
Adjunctive aripiprazole significantly improved sexual dysfunction in schizophrenia patients with hyperprolactinemia. This treatment effectively reduced prolactin levels and various sexual issues over 24 weeks.
Area of Science:
- Psychiatry
- Endocrinology
- Sexual Medicine
Background:
- Antipsychotic medications can induce hyperprolactinemia, leading to sexual dysfunction.
- Aripiprazole is known to improve hyperprolactinemia, but its impact on associated sexual dysfunction requires further investigation.
Purpose of the Study:
- To evaluate the efficacy of adjunctive aripiprazole in treating sexual dysfunction in schizophrenia patients with antipsychotic-induced hyperprolactinemia.
Main Methods:
- A 24-week study involving 22 Japanese schizophrenia patients with hyperprolactinemia and sexual dysfunction.
- Aripiprazole was administered flexibly, with assessments of serum prolactin, sexual function (Nagoya Sexual Function Questionnaire), and clinical severity (CGI-S) at regular intervals.
Main Results:
- Adjunctive aripiprazole significantly reduced prolactin levels starting from week 4.
- Significant improvements in overall sexual dysfunction were observed from week 8 onwards.
- Specific improvements included reduced erectile dysfunction in males and decreased menstrual irregularity and galactorrhea in females by week 24.
Conclusions:
- Adjunctive aripiprazole appears to be a beneficial treatment for sexual dysfunction associated with hyperprolactinemia in schizophrenia patients.
- Further research with larger sample sizes is warranted to confirm these findings.
